Accident with multiple injuries in Petersberg - Four injured, including child, in Hesse highway collision near Petersberg
A serious traffic collision in Petersberg, Hesse, left four people injured on December 18, 2025. Among them was a child, while emergency services rushed all victims to hospital. The crash involved two vehicles and forced authorities to shut down the road temporarily.
The accident happened as a 32-year-old man attempted to turn left from the A7 highway onto B485. His car collided with another driven by a 59-year-old woman. The man, his 34-year-old passenger, and a four-year-old girl suffered minor injuries, while the older driver was seriously hurt.
The injured remain under medical care, with the older driver in a more critical condition. The road has since reopened, but the investigation into the accident is ongoing. Officials have not yet confirmed what led to the collision.
